Difficult to say: I don't see any image(s) available for the bite. In general tick bites don't require prophylactic(pre-emptive) antibiotics. The case in which you would, is if the tick can be identified as I. scapularis(the type associated with Lyme disease), it has been attached for at least an estimated 36 hours and you live, or were traveling, in an area with a high rate of Lyme disease.
